引言
在当今的网络环境中,科学上网已经成为了许多用户的一项基本需求。根据不同的需求与使用背景,*UNIX系统*提供了多种科学上网的方式。本篇文章将深入探讨如何使用*UNIX系统*进行科学上网,包括常见的技术与工具,以及具体的配置与使用教程。
什么是科学上网?
科学上网通常指的是通过各种工具技术手段绕过网络限制,访问被屏蔽的网站。在*UNIX系统*上,我们主要使用以下几种方法:
- VPN(虚拟专用网)
- SSH(安全外壳)
- 代理(如SOCKS5等)
UNIX系统的常用科学上网工具
在*UNIX系统*中,有多种科学上网工具可供选择,以下是一些常用的工具介绍:
1. VPN工具
- OpenVPN
- WireGuard
2. SSH工具
- SSH客户端(如OpenSSH)
3. 代理工具
- ShadowSocks
- V2Ray
使用VPN进行科学上网
1. 安装OpenVPN
如果选择使用OpenVPN,可以通过以下步骤进行安装: bash sudo apt-get install openvpn
2. 配置OpenVPN客户端
- 将*.ovpn文件下载到本地并记住路径。
- 使用以下命令连接到VPN: bash sudo openvpn –config /path/to/your.ovpn
3. 使用 WireGuard 进行科学上网
-
安装WireGuard: bash sudo apt-get install wireguard
-
配置WireGuard: 需要编辑配置文件,输入相应的服务器信息。
使用SSH进行科学上网
1. SSH功能简介
SSH不仅能提供安全的远程登录,还可以作为一个代理工具来实现科学上网。
2. 设置SSH连接
- 利用以下命令建立SSH tunnels: bash ssh -D 1080 -C -N your_username@your_server_ip
3. 配置浏览器
- 在设置中添加SOCKS代理,设置值为127.0.0.1:1080。
代理(如ShadowSocks或者V2Ray)使用说明
1. 安装ShadowSocks
bash sudo apt-get install shadowsocks
2. 配置ShadowSocks
- 创建配置文件/etc/shadowsocks.json,添加服务器信息。
3. 启动服务
bash ssserver -c /etc/shadowsocks.json -d start
注重私密与数据安全
每当使用科学上网工具时,有必要关注私密数据的安全。尽量选择拥有良好口碑的服务提供者,并使用加密连接。在使用SSH和VPN服务时,务必定期更换密码以提高安全等级。
常见问题解答(FAQ)
1. 如何在UNIX中设置DNS?
为了正常访问互联网,务必要正确配置DNS服务器。通常可在/etc/resolv.conf文件中编辑DNS信息,建议使用公共DNS,比如:
nameserver 8.8.8.8
nameserver 1.1.1.1
2. 如果VPN连接失败,应该怎么办?
- 确认您的网络连接正常。
- 检查VPN配置的文件是否完整。
- 尝试重启VPN服务,或访问相关的支持论坛获取帮助。
3. 有没有免费的科学上网工具推荐?
虽然有免费工具可供选择,但一般安全性较差,推荐使用相对成熟的包括:
- Shadowsocks
- V2Ray 改编版本。
4. 如何提高科学上网速度?
- 优先选择Ping值较低的服务器。
- 若使用VPN连接,尝试使用跨国流量转发服务。
结论
掌握*UNIX科学上网*的方法能够帮助我们安全并高效地连接到全球信息网络。不断更新工具的使用策略、提供的服务器以及配置的方法可以确保我们在网络上的自由和隐私。希望通过本文的记录,能够让网友们游刃有余地使用科学上网技拥有更开放的上网体验!